Ordinance 31833

Introduced as Council Bill 20371

Title

An Ordinance providing for the improvement of Whitman Avenue, from Kilbourne Street to North Forty-fifth Street; Aurora Avenue, from Kilbourne Street to Motor Place, Linden Avenue, from Kilbourne Street to North Forty-second Street; North Thirty-ninth Street, from Fremont Avenue to Woodland Park Avenue; North Fortieth Street, from Linden Avenue to Woodland Park Avenue, North Forty-second Street, from Fremont Avenue to Woodland Park Avenue; North Forty-third Street, from Phinney Avenue to Woodland Park Avenue, all in the City of Seattle, by resurfacing, curbs and gutters, concrete sidewalks, wooden crosswalks and providing for the necessary surface drainage, all in accordance with Resolution No. 3997 of the City Council of the City of Seattle, creating a local improvement district therefor, and providing that payment of said improvement be made by special assessments upon property in said district payable by mode of "Payment by Bonds".
